Jaclyn Speiden Obituary


Jaclyn "Jackie" Wymer Speiden, 54, of Stephens City passed away on Wednesday, July 12, 2023, at Winchester Medical Center surrounded by her loving family.

A Celebration of Life for Jackie will be held at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day, July 22, 2023, at St. Stephen Lutheran Church, 15737 Back Road, Strasburg, VA with Pastor Robert Wise officiating. The family will receive friends one hour prior to the service.

Jackie was born in Winchester, VA on June 24, 1969, a daughter of Sue and Ed Wymer.

She graduated from Strasburg High School in 1987. She formerly worked as an administrative assistant for a construction company and then later became a transcriptionist. She was a member of St. Stephen Lutheran Church; she loved to sing and play the violin. She was the fiddle playing angel in the St. Stephen's bluegrass "Angel Band". She loved to spend time with her family, especially her grandchildren.

She is survived by her husband of 15 years, Robert Speiden; her children Timothy McDonald, Riley McDonald, Corey Peer (Lucy); her stepchildren Mandi Lamb (Jeff), Jenni Jones (John), Candy Beghtol (Jamie) and Kristi Speiden; grandchildren Hayden McDonald, Jackson McDonald, Keegan Herbaugh, Kinslee McDonald, and Coleman Peer; sister Nikki Taylor (Paul); brother Russell Wymer (Bridget); and nephew, Reese Taylor.

In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to St. Stephen Lutheran Church, 15737 Back Road, Strasburg, VA 22657.
